Ticket: Staging env misconfigured for Siftgate bloom filter

The bloom layer in front of the Pellet KV store is rejecting all lookups in staging because the env file was copied from the dev template without credentials. False-positive tuning values are fine; only the auth line is missing. To unblock the weekly demo, the Pellet admission secret must be set on the following line.

env line for yaguf-fajop: LEDGER_TOKEN13=fb08984397349

## Formula sandboxing — quick intro

Heads up before any release: user-supplied formulas in Calcrest run inside the Lattice sandbox, which caps execution at 50ms and blocks all I/O. No release should ship with the sandbox feature gate off, ever — that's been the cause of two rollbacks. The gate check is part of the release script, but verify it manually anyway. The verification steps are written up internally here.

operations page: https://jenkins.zemvarcloud.local/job/merge_requests/repo/build/73930b4b30f0a8ed

Build provenance — Lagwatch replica alarm. The read-replica lag alarm at Ferndale Systems fires when replication delay exceeds the configured threshold for two consecutive checks. Every alarm deployment is traceable to a signed build artifact; contractors should verify provenance before modifying thresholds. The current production build is identified by the token shown below.

session token of yahof-bajeg = htk9_0d43d44ed